The European Union has collected 1.4 billion euros from frozen Russian assets. This money will be transferred to Ukraine. The European Union continues to impose various sanctions on Russia to punish its economy for the war against Ukraine.
The money collected from frozen Russian assets will be used to compensate for the damage Ukraine suffered due to the war. The European Union continues to provide support to Ukraine.
The European Union's move is part of a series of measures taken against Russia's war on Ukraine. Russia is facing heavy criticism from the international community for its war on Ukraine.
